Functional Description ? help Back to Top
Source Description
UniProtProbable transcription factor (Probable). Is required, together with TT16/AGL32 for the maternal control of endothelium formation, which is essential for female gametophyte development and fertilization, and seed formation (PubMed:22176531). {ECO:0000269|PubMed:22176531, ECO:0000305}.
